Panasonic has refreshed its Thoughbook rugged laptop PC series with four new models featuring the Intel “Santa Rosa” notebook platform and enhanced protection from drops and spills. The new laptops are the CF-T7, CF-W7, CF-Y7, and the CF-R7 (for the Japanese market only).
“The new 7-series machines, aimed at corporate users, are beefier than the current 5-series machines and can survive a fall from a greater height. The new models can be dropped from 76 centimeters — the height of an average desk — while switched on and still work, according to Panasonic. Its current Thoughbook models for the corporate PC market are rated for a 30 cm drop but only when switched off,” PC World reports.
The announced Thoughbooks also have an “irrigation system” for the keyboard which can route water away from important system components to a “drain” at the base of the computer.
The Panasonic CF-T7 has a 12.1-inch XGA screen and has no built-in optical drive, while the CF-W7, with the same display, adds a built-in DVD burner. The high-end CF-Y7 has a 14.1-inch screen and a DVD burner. The Japan-only CF-R7 has a 10.4-inch XGA display. It has no optical drive. Along with a “Santa Rosa” Intel Core 2 processor, these latops incorporate 1GB of system memory, and 80GB hard drives. All models include a 802.11 a/b/g wireless LAN. The new 802.11 draft-n variant is not supported reportedly.
The CF-T7, CF-W7, and CF-Y7, will be launched in Europe on November 27th. North American and Asian launch dates will be around the same time as those in Europe.
Panasonic Thoughbook CF-T7, CF-W7, CF-Y7, CF-R7 Specifications, Prices
* W7: 12.1-inch XGA display, Core 2 Duo 1.06GHz U7500 CPU, 1GB of RAM, 80GB hard drive, 802.11a/b/g, ¥250,000 ($2,169), available November 16th
* T7 (pictured): 12.1-inch XGA display, Core 2 Duo 1.06GHz U7500 CPU, 1GB of RAM, 80GB hard drive, 802.11a/b/g, ¥220,000 ($1,909), available October 19th
* R7: 10.4-inch XGA display, Core 2 Duo 1.06GHz U7500 CPU, 1GB of RAM, 80GB hard drive, 802.11a/b/g, ¥205,000 ($1,779), available October 19th
* R7 Premium Edition: 10.4-inch XGA display, Core 2 Duo 1.2GHz U7600 CPU, 1GB of RAM, 80GB hard drive, 802.11a/b/g, 205,000, available October 26th
* Y7: 14.1-inch SXGA+ display, Core 2 Duo 1.6GHz L7500, 1GB of RAM, 80GB hard drive, 802.11a/b/g, ¥270,000 ($2,343), available October 19th
